Position Summary
 

As part of the team responsible for the management of the resolution for defects identified on board AOPVs and JSS based in Halifax, NS, the Corrective Maintenance Coordinator is providing support to the Corrective Maintenance Lead and the broader Service Delivery team by managing and coordinating the resolution of defects on both AOPVs and JSS vessels.

Key Areas of Responsibility
 

  • Manage day-to-day activities related to defect management on AOPVs and JSS based in Halifax, NS;

  • Act as the key point of contact for all stakeholders (internal and external) regarding the AJISS Corrective Maintenance process;

  • Facilitate and attend weekly AAT/pre-AAT (AJISS Assignment Team) meetings with internal and external stakeholders;

  • Maintain and update Warranty status information as provided by the Build Project from Canada;

  • Prepare and distribute AAT Meeting Notes to all stakeholders;

  • Support the CM Team Lead in tracking and resolving Corrective Maintenance assigned to Thales;

  • Execute assigned actions in Thales tools (e.g., MAXIMO, JIRA, Confluence) to ensure workflow momentum for all defects assigned to Thales

  • Draft and finalize Statements of Work (SOW) for defect resolution, as required;

  • Review and ensure that maintenance instructions are complete and sufficient for service providers to complete assigned maintenance operations;

  • Ensure subcontracted service providers have the necessary paperwork and materials to complete designated maintenance tasks;

  • Oversee maintenance activities being conducted by service providers ensuring that the work is being conducted to the required quality in a safe and environmentally friendly manner;

  • Ensure service provider records are complete and up to date;

  • Provide internal (e.g., SMLs, Coastal Engineering) and external (e.g., FTA, MEPM, Ship Staff) stakeholders with data and status updates to achieve material readiness objectives

  • Clean and update historical Corrective Maintenance data in both Thales and Canada tools.

  • Support OPDEF and Quick Response MAXIMO Work Order creation

  • Manage and coordinate the recording of corrective maintenance data in Thales data management systems from initiation to close-out;

  • Build and maintain collaborative relationships with FTA/MEPM to align technical databases (Thales and Canada) and ensure data consistency across the fleet

  • Provide FTA with required data and presentation materials for the Material State Disclosure Conference (MSDC)

  • Manage data and status in DRMIS for all defects assigned to Thales, in coordination with FTA/MEPM

  • Upload Notifications from DRMIS to Thales tools as required

  • Support FTA in the management and creation of N1 records in DRMIS;

  • Support internal close-out OQE processes for defects assigned to Thales to satisfy FTA and MEPM requirements;

  • Serve as a backup for the CM Team Lead, providing coverage and support during absences or peak periods;

  • Act as a Subject Matter Expert (SME) for CM data management tools (e.g., JIRA, MAXIMO, xFRACAS, DRMIS);

  • Monitor key metrics related to the Corrective Maintenance process;

  • Provide onsite CM SME support during Ship PLOWs;

  • Coordinate with the Planning team for Corrective Maintenance integration into SWP/DWP;

  • Provide general project and administrative support to the Waterfront Service Delivery Team;

  • Identify areas of concern and drive improvements by liaising with relevant stakeholders;

  • Foster teamwork with all levels of the customer, leveraging the Relational Contracting (RC) model and the AJISS Enterprise Charter;

  • Update project procedures and templates as requested;

  • Perform other project coordination duties as assigned;

Basic Qualifications

The following minimum requirements must be met:
 

  • Minimum 2-year technical program diploma offered by a recognized technical institute or certified as a technician or technologist  by a recognized provincial licensing body in a relevant field or certified to the QL-5 level of military technical training;

  • Strong computer literacy, with proven experience with Microsoft products especially Word, Excel and PowerPoint essential;

  • Strong interpersonal skills and demonstrated experience interfacing between various internal/external stakeholders within a project;

  • Strong organizational skills and ability to balance multiple priorities;

  • Fluent in English;

Preferred Qualifications
 

  • Possess a minimum of 5 years of demonstrated technical professional work experience in the marine sector within the last 10 years;

  • Experience working within a defense environment with active defense force personnel;

  • Experience with the Defense Resource Management Information System (DRMIS), or comparable document management system is advantageous;

  • Experience in ship-refit and repair activities is advantageous;

Physical Demands

Predominantly office based, but will also be required to work onboard Naval Vessels.

Will be required to undertake inspections, including confined space entry, on Naval ships involving bending and twisting. Tasks may also requiring working at heights.

Special Position Requirements

Schedule: 40 Hours per week during Core Business Hours Monday-Friday.

Physical Environment:  Office or onboard Naval ships alongside in harbor, or at sea, therefore must meet all federal government requirements to access Canadian government facilities, including naval dockyards

Travel: Occasional domestic or international travel will be required, which will include access to government facilities and assets, including naval vessels


Customer Location Based or Site Visits: Required to work from shipyards and Naval Dockyards during Work Periods.
